混合购APP开发概述
混合购APP开发是一种结合了原生应用和Web应用开发技术的模式,旨在为用户提供跨平台的购物体验。通过使用HTML5、CSS3和JavaScript等Web技术,开发者可以创建能够在多个操作系统上运行的应用程序。这种开发方式不仅降低了开发成本和时间,还能提供接近原生应用的用户体验。
混合购APP开发的优势
-
跨平台兼容性
混合购APP允许开发者使用一套代码同时适配iOS和Android平台,大大减少了开发工作量。这种方式特别适合初创企业和小型团队,能够快速推出产品。 -
成本效益
由于只需编写一次代码,混合购APP开发显著降低了开发和维护成本。对于预算有限的企业来说,这种模式提供了经济高效的解决方案。 -
用户体验
现代混合开发框架如React Native和Flutter,能够实现流畅的用户界面和快速的响应速度,使得混合购APP在性能上接近原生应用。 -
快速迭代与更新
混合购APP的代码主要基于Web技术,开发者可以像更新Web应用一样进行远程更新,无需用户手动下载新版本。这种特性提高了用户体验和应用的维护效率。
混合购APP开发的技术原理
混合购APP开发的核心在于使用特定的开发框架,如Ionic、React Native或Flutter。这些框架通过将Web技术封装成原生组件,使得开发者能够利用JavaScript与原生代码进行交互。具体来说,开发者可以通过JSBridge技术实现JavaScript与原生代码的调用,从而实现复杂的功能。
混合购APP的应用场景
-
电商平台
混合购APP在电商领域的应用尤为广泛。它能够为用户提供个性化的购物体验,包括商品推荐、便捷的支付功能和流畅的浏览体验。 -
企业级应用
对于需要快速部署和跨平台运行的企业级应用,混合购APP开发是一个理想的选择。它可以帮助企业快速构建移动办公、客户管理等应用,提高工作效率。
混合购APP开发的未来趋势
-
智能化与自动化
随着人工智能技术的发展,混合购APP将更加注重智能化应用。例如,通过AI算法分析用户行为,提供个性化推荐和服务。 -
安全性与隐私保护
用户对数据安全和隐私保护的关注日益增加,混合购APP开发将更加注重安全性设计,包括数据加密和用户隐私设置。 -
跨平台一致性
未来的混合购APP将致力于在不同平台和设备上提供一致的用户体验。通过不断优化框架和工具的性能,确保用户在使用不同设备时都能获得相似的体验。
结论
混合购APP开发作为一种新兴的开发模式,凭借其跨平台、低成本和高性能的优势,正在改变移动应用开发的格局。随着技术的不断进步和应用场景的不断拓展,混合购APP开发将迎来更加广阔的发展前景。对于开发者而言,掌握混合购APP开发技术将是提升竞争力、赢得市场的关键所在。